I did however not allow her to be jaelous of my other two. That was a problem for months. She would growl and snap if Lola my other dog came on my bed and stuff. The worst thing for Tillie is me being angry with her. She hates it. If she snapped or growled I'd make her get away from me and sit away on the floor and ignore her. Then after a while call her back and that's her punishment over. It took a few months but it worked.
